Full Job Description

Travels assigned routes, assisting stranded motorists with vehicle services such as fuel, water, tire changes, jump starts, etc. Travels assigned routes, assisting emergency response agencies during incidents. Clears travel lanes of disabled vehicles and debris and assists with emergency traffic control. Records incident response activities at incident scenes, and communicates this information, as needed, to the Traffic Management Center (TMC) dispatcher. Inputs all recorded data daily. Assists in the cleaning and maintaining of incident response vehicles and facilities as directed. Performs other related duties as assigned.

Requirements

A high school diploma and six (6) months of related experience; or an approved acceptable equivalence. Necessary Special Requirement: Employee must possess a valid motor vehicle operator's license.

The physical demands for the essential functions of this position involve bending, stooping, reaching, twisting, climbing, balancing, kneeling, pushing, pulling, grasping and physically manipulating objects of varying size, shape, weight, and material. Must be able to lift up to 60 lbs. This position requires corrected 20/20 vision. May be required to work outside of normal work schedule, especially during inclement weather and/or other departmental-related emergencies. Frequently exposed to outside environment in all weather conditions and noise on a daily basis. Work environment is generally in a truck and in close proximity to heavy and fast-moving traffic. Position requires attending and successfully completing training classes on diverse topics such as Traffic Control, Basic First Aid, CPR, Hazardous Material Identification, and Defensive Driving. Due to location and severity of incidents, this position will require working in close proximity to heavy, fast-moving vehicular traffic. Position requires mobility, manual dexterity, and excellent vision. Response duties may take longer than assigned hours; therefore, extra hours may be required. Position also requires the occasional working during inclement weather. Position requires the employee to deal with co-workers, professional colleagues, and the general public in a productive and courteous manner. Position requires sitting and/or standing for prolonged periods of time, seeing, hearing, and speaking. Position requires lifting and utilizing a variety of equipment and supplies, which may weigh up to 80 pounds.
